Bro,

I'm not sure but from what you wrote it sounds like you're not close to ready for juice.

How old are you? what are your stats?

You need to get your diet and your training down cold to the point where you have maxed out potential before even considering juice. For example, how about 1 year with no missed workouts on a clean high protein diet. Then, when BF is down below say 10%, evaluate your progress.

A cycle won't boost you're morale or ambition -- you have have got to have those in abundance before a cycle can even be considered.

A couple of inches -- you're kidding right? How many years?

If you don't got the discipline I spoke of above you won't add anything to your body with juice and will probably just cause yourself a bunch of harm.
